Sir Brooke Boothby, 9th Baronet
1809–1865 (age 56)
Biography
Sir Brooke Boothby, 9th Baronet, was an Anglican priest who dedicated his life to religious service and pastoral care. As a member of the distinguished Boothby baronetcy, he combined his inherited status with genuine ecclesiastical commitment, serving his congregation with devotion throughout his ministry.
Sir Brooke passed away in 1865 at the age of fifty-six and was laid to rest in the Parish Church of St Mary in Welwyn. His life of service to the Church of England left a lasting impression on those he ministered to during his years of active priesthood.
